Illuminating the Chaise Longue Nook

Now, let’s talk about lighting. When it comes to creating the perfect ambiance in a chaise longue nook, there are a few key factors to consider.

Ambient Lighting

First and foremost, you’ll want to establish a warm, cozy base of ambient lighting. This is the overall illumination that sets the tone for the space, providing a soft, diffused glow that envelops the entire nook. In my case, I opted for a floor lamp with a soft, dimmable bulb that casts a gentle, inviting light.

But ambient lighting doesn’t have to come from a single source. You could also consider strategically placed wall sconces, recessed lighting, or even a small, decorative chandelier to add depth and dimension to the space.

Task Lighting

Once you’ve got the ambient lighting dialed in, it’s time to consider task lighting. This is the more focused illumination that allows you to actually see and read while nestled in your chaise longue. A well-placed table lamp or a floor lamp with a directional head can do the trick, providing just the right amount of light for your literary pursuits.

Accent Lighting

And finally, don’t forget about accent lighting. This is the extra touch that adds visual interest and highlights specific elements within the nook. Perhaps you have a piece of artwork or a decorative vase that you want to showcase – a strategically placed accent light can do just the trick.

Accent lighting can come in the form of small, directional spotlights, or even subtle string lights woven through the space. The key is to use it sparingly, just enough to add a touch of elegance and drama to the overall ambiance.

Finding the Perfect Lighting Balance

Now, you might be thinking, “Okay, that all sounds great, but how do I actually put it all together?” Well, my friend, that’s where the real magic happens.

It’s all about finding the perfect balance between those three lighting elements – ambient, task, and accent. Too much ambient light and your cozy nook might feel more like a showroom. Too much task lighting and you risk losing that intimate, cocoon-like feel. And too many accent lights can make the space feel busy and cluttered.

The key is to experiment, adjust, and find what works best for your unique chaise longue nook. Maybe you start with a bright ambient light and gradually dim it down until you achieve that perfect, moody glow. Or perhaps you play with the placement and intensity of your task lighting, finding the sweet spot that allows you to read comfortably without disrupting the overall atmosphere.
